Output 8dfc82978261917afb30c080967d5d42b9975a79568f04a9e0a1ab24fbb97161:12

value
1917691654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79fc3373aed8552111cc4470f3b0658fada8d6f4 OP_EQUAL
address
3Cp1ozBrPfKJMoxKguPMGBXyo5r6Q8SrF9
transaction
8dfc82978261917afb30c080967d5d42b9975a79568f04a9e0a1ab24fbb97161
spent
true